Re: filmscanners: Comparing scanners



"Mike Duncan" <mgduncan@esper.com> wrote:
> >Just a thought - I don't know the guts of how Photoshop produces
histograms,
> >so this may not work as well as I think it could... Would it be a useful
> >comparison of scanners to scan the same slide with Vuescan to raw files
> >and compare the histograms?
> I suggest Stouffer gray target from www.darkroom-innovations.com. You'll
> find media settings in VS make big difference in OD range.

A gray target would be nice but I don't think I could afford the import at
the moment.  Media settings probably do affect OD range as they would be
curve transforms of some sort based on the film response curve.  They
shouldn't affect the raw scans; as far as I know, only the brightness
setting affects the raw scan by changing the integration time.
